
Located on the eastern shore of Lake Como, Mandello del Lario is a charming town with historic streets and scenic waterfront views. It’s renowned as the birthplace of Moto Guzzi, an iconic motorcycle manufacturer with a fascinating museum showcasing vintage bikes. Visitors can explore the medieval Church of San Lorenzo, wander along the promenade, or embark on hikes leading to dramatic mountain viewpoints. Local restaurants serve delicious Lombard specialties, and ferries connect it to nearby lakeside towns, making it a convenient base for exploring the region. The weather is typically mild, perfect for swimming or boating during summer months. Don’t miss panoramic views from the surrounding foothills or a day trip to Varenna, Bellagio, or Lecco.
